HTML基础知识详解:标记、结构与文字图像处理
需积分: 10 133 浏览量
更新于2024-07-17
收藏 366KB PDF 举报
"HTML知识点汇总"
HTML(Hypertext Markup Language)是用于创建网页的标准标记语言,它通过一系列的标记来定义文档结构和超链接。HTML起源于SGML(Standard Generalized Markup Language),随着时间的发展,逐渐演变成现代网页开发的基础。
在HTML中,标记是其核心元素,它们通常以尖括号包围,分为单标记和双标记两种类型。单标记如 `<br/>` 和 `<hr/>` 不需要闭合,而双标记如 `<p>段落</p>` 需要有开始和结束标签。XHTML 强制要求所有标记使用小写字母,并且单标记也要闭合,属性值需用双引号括起,以提高代码规范性。
HTML的基本结构由 `<html>` 标签包裹,内部包含 `<head>` 和 `<body>` 两部分。`<head>` 标签用于定义页面元数据,如标题 `<title>`,而 `<body>` 包含实际的网页内容。注释使用 `<!-- 注释内容 -->` 的形式。
在处理文字样式时,可以使用 `<font>` 标签来改变字体、大小和颜色。`face` 属性指定字体,可以使用多个字体名称以逗号分隔作为备选;`size` 属性调整文字大小,通常使用数字1到7表示不同级别;`color` 属性设置颜色,既可使用 RGB 值(如 #000000)也可使用预定义的颜色名称(如 red)。
设置正文标题则使用 `<h1>` 至 `<h6>` 标签,数字越大,标题级别越低,字体相应变小。这些标题标签在组织页面结构和提供搜索引擎优化(SEO)上下文中非常重要。
此外,HTML还提供了许多其他元素来丰富网页内容,如列表(`<ul>`、`<ol>`、`<li>`)、段落(`<p>`)、链接(`<a>`)、图像(`<img>`)等。图像标签 `<img>` 通过 `src` 属性指定图片源,`alt` 属性提供替代文本,以确保可访问性。链接的 `<a>` 标签则通过 `href` 属性定义目标URL。
表格(`<table>`、`<tr>`、`<td>`、`<th>`)用于数据展示,表单元素(`<form>`、`<input>`、`<select>`、`<textarea>`)则用于用户交互,如输入和提交数据。
CSS(Cascading Style Sheets)通常与HTML一起使用,以分离内容和表现,实现更精细的样式控制和布局设计。JavaScript 是另一种关键技术,它可以为网页添加动态功能和交互性。
HTML的最新版本是HTML5,它引入了许多新特性,如语义化标签(`<header>`、`<footer>`、`<article>` 等),媒体元素(`<audio>`、`<video>`),以及离线存储和拖放功能等,进一步增强了网页的现代功能和用户体验。
总而言之,HTML是构建网页的基础,理解和掌握HTML的结构和元素是成为一名合格Web开发者的第一步。通过结合CSS和JavaScript,可以创建出美观、功能丰富的网页应用。
2021-06-25 上传
2022-07-14 上传
2021-10-10 上传
2022-06-24 上传
2020-03-23 上传
2023-05-03 上传
2021-09-20 上传
2022-10-31 上传
2021-11-06 上传
tsui_sh
- 粉丝: 2
- 资源: 8
最新资源
- BottleJS快速入门:演示JavaScript依赖注入优势
- vConsole插件使用教程:输出与复制日志文件
- Node.js v12.7.0版本发布 - 适合高性能Web服务器与网络应用
- Android中实现图片的双指和双击缩放功能
- Anum Pinki英语至乌尔都语开源词典:23000词汇会话
- 三菱电机SLIMDIP智能功率模块在变频洗衣机的应用分析
- 用JavaScript实现的剪刀石头布游戏指南
- Node.js v12.22.1版发布 - 跨平台JavaScript环境新选择
- Infix修复发布:探索新的中缀处理方式
- 罕见疾病酶替代疗法药物非临床研究指导原则报告
- Node.js v10.20.0 版本发布,性能卓越的服务器端JavaScript
- hap-java-client:Java实现的HAP客户端库解析
- Shreyas Satish的GitHub博客自动化静态站点技术解析
- vtomole个人博客网站建设与维护经验分享
- MEAN.JS全栈解决方案:打造MongoDB、Express、AngularJS和Node.js应用
- 东南大学网络空间安全学院复试代码解析